How to include external Hard Drives for cleaning?

I have no problem with CCleaner that I couldn't fix, but I was wondering how I could get CCleaner to include external hard drives or separate partitions in its scan for cleaning. Any suggestions. I've looked in settings and everywhere I could snoop and found no option.

The Obvious way is simply Options > Include > Add then Browse for the drive you want to be included in the cleaning process and from there you can also specify which file types you want to be cleaned.

Make sure you have the later versions of CCleaner so you can have this option but I am not sure if CCleaner is able to distinguish normal files from junk files inside external hard drives.

CCleaner can't clean anything on external hard drives, unless you are using an external drive to put folders like your profile or the temp folder.
